Understanding Water Thickeners

Water thickeners, also known as rheology modifiers or thixotropes, are substances that increase the viscosity of a liquid, making it thicker and more stable. They work by forming a network of particles or molecules that resist flow, thus altering the liquid’s rheological properties. Thickeners can be used in a wide range of industries, including food and beverage, pharmaceuticals, personal care, construction, and more.

Types of Water Thickeners

There are several types of water thickeners, each with its unique characteristics, advantages, and applications.

Natural Thickeners

Natural thickeners are derived from plants, animals, or minerals. Examples include:

  • Gum Arabic: Derived from the sap of the acacia tree, gum arabic is a natural adhesive and thickener commonly used in food, beverages, and pharmaceuticals.
  • Pectin: A complex carbohydrate found in fruit, pectin is often used as a gelling agent in jams, jellies, and marmalades.
  • Carrageenan: A polysaccharide extracted from red algae, carrageenan is widely used in dairy products, meat alternatives, and plant-based milks.

Synthetic Thickeners

Synthetic thickeners, on the other hand, are man-made chemicals designed to provide specific properties and benefits.

  • Xanthan Gum: A microbial polysaccharide, xanthan gum is a highly effective thickener and stabilizer used in a broad range of applications, including food, cosmetics, and oil drilling.
  • Polyacrylate: A synthetic polymer, polyacrylate is often used in personal care products, such as toothpaste and shampoo, due to its excellent thickening and stabilizing properties.
  • Carboxy Methyl Cellulose (CMC): A derivative of cellulose, CMC is a popular thickener and stabilizer in food, pharmaceuticals, and construction materials.

What is a water thickener?

A water thickener is a type of product that is designed to thicken liquids, making them easier to consume for individuals who have difficulty swallowing or have certain medical conditions. Water thickeners are often used to thicken water, juice, and other liquids to make them safer to drink for people who are at risk of choking or aspiration.

Water thickeners come in various forms, including powders, gels, and liquids, and they work by absorbing excess liquid and swelling to create a thicker consistency. This makes it easier for individuals to drink without worrying about choking or experiencing discomfort. Water thickeners are commonly used in healthcare settings, such as hospitals and long-term care facilities, but they can also be used at home with the guidance of a healthcare professional.

What are the different types of water thickeners?

There are several types of water thickeners available, each with its own unique characteristics and benefits. Some common types of water thickeners include xanthan gum, guar gum, and starch-based thickeners. Xanthan gum is a popular choice because it is easy to mix and creates a smooth, consistent texture. Guar gum is another popular option that is high in fiber and can help support digestive health. Starch-based thickeners, such as cornstarch and tapioca starch, are also commonly used and are often less expensive than other types of thickeners.

The type of water thickener that is best for an individual will depend on their specific needs and preferences. For example, someone who is looking for a thickener that is easy to mix and creates a smooth texture may prefer xanthan gum, while someone who is looking for a thickener that is high in fiber may prefer guar gum. It’s important to consult with a healthcare professional to determine the best type of water thickener for a specific individual.

How do I mix a water thickener?

Mixing a water thickener correctly is important to achieve the desired consistency and to ensure the thickener is effective. The instructions for mixing a water thickener will vary depending on the specific product, so it’s important to follow the manufacturer’s instructions. Generally, the thickener is added to the liquid in a specific ratio, such as one scoop of thickener to a certain amount of liquid.

It’s important to mix the thickener slowly and thoroughly to avoid lumps and to ensure the thickener is fully dissolved. It’s also important to wait a few minutes after mixing to allow the thickener to fully absorb the liquid and achieve the desired consistency. If the thickener is not mixed correctly, it may not provide the desired level of thickening, which can be a safety risk for individuals who have difficulty swallowing.
